Transfer pricing comes into the picture when the forces of market competition are wiped out. The most widely applied practice is the so called “arm’s length principle”, meaning that goods and services transferred between related companies should be valued using market prices, which unrelated parties would agree on.

From 2010 to 2015, the number of patent applications filed with the State IntellectualProperty Office tripled from 300,000 to over 900,000. Third, the government places far greater priority on the quantity over the quality of patents.
